Software Engineer

4 Staffing Corp
Upper Merion Township, PA
Category Engineering
Job Description
Software Engineer position available for a leading financial services company. Design, develop, and maintain software applications that drive business forward. Collaborate with cross-functional teams to deliver high-quality software solutions.

Requirements

  • Bachelor's degree in Computer Science, Software Engineering, or a related field (or equivalent experience)
  • Strong knowledge of software engineering concepts, practices, and methodologies
  • Expertise in C# and.NET 6
  • Proficiency in SQL Server query validation using SSMS Profiler
  • Familiarity with Reflection for code flexibility
  • Experience with Entity Framework Core (version 7) and Code First Database Design
  • Knowledge of EF Tools for efficient data access
  • Angular-based UI development experience with TypeScript
  • Hands-on experience with CICD pipelines, Git, TeamCity, and Octopus
  • Familiarity with containerization technologies such as Docker and Kubernetes
  • Prior experience with Azure Cloud technologies is a plus
  • Strong problem-solving skills and attention to detail
  • Effective communication and teamwork skills
  • Continuous learning mindset to stay updated with emerging technologies

Benefits

  • Competitive compensation
  • Benefits package
]]>